Statement of Partnership Authority.

(a)A partnership may file with the Secretary of State a statement of partnership authority, which:
(1)must include:
(i)the name of the partnership;
(ii)the street address of its chief executive office and of one office in this state, if there is one; and (iii) the name and mailing address of an agent appointed and maintained by the partnership for the purpose of subsection (b) of this section; or (iv) the names and mailing addresses of the partners authorized to execute an instrument transferring real property held in the name of the partnership; and (2) may state the authority, or limitations on the authority, of some or all of the partners to enter into other transactions on behalf of the partnership and any other matter.
